#113c5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#113c5c is composed of 6.7% red, 23.5%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.5%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 205.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 21.4%. #113c5c color hex could be obtained by blending #2278b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#113c5c color description : Very dark blue.
#113c5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#113c5c has RGB values of R:17, G:60,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1129564.
